import type { Client, Config, RequestOptions } from './types';
import {
buildUrl,
createConfig,
createInterceptors,
getParseAs,
mergeConfigs,
mergeHeaders,
setAuthParams,
} from './utils';
type ReqInit = Omit<RequestInit, 'body' | 'headers'> & {
body?: any;
headers: ReturnType<typeof mergeHeaders>;
};
export const createClient = (config: Config = {}): Client => {
let _config = mergeConfigs(createConfig(), config);
const getConfig = (): Config => ({ ..._config });
const setConfig = (config: Config): Config => {
_config = mergeConfigs(_config, config);
return getConfig();
};
const interceptors = createInterceptors<
Request,
Response,
unknown,
RequestOptions
>();
// @ts-expect-error
const request: Client['request'] = async (options) => {
const opts = {
..._config,
...options,
fetch: options.fetch ?? _config.fetch ?? globalThis.fetch,
headers: mergeHeaders(_config.headers, options.headers),
};
if (opts.security) {
await setAuthParams({
...opts,
security: opts.security,
});
}
if (opts.body && opts.bodySerializer) {
opts.body = opts.bodySerializer(opts.body);
}
// remove Content-Type header if body is empty to avoid sending invalid requests
if (opts.body === undefined || opts.body === '') {
opts.headers.delete('Content-Type');
}
const url = buildUrl(opts);
const requestInit: ReqInit = {
redirect: 'follow',
...opts,
};
let request = new Request(url, requestInit);
for (const fn of interceptors.request._fns) {
request = await fn(request, opts);
}
// fetch must be assigned here, otherwise it would throw the error:
// TypeError: Failed to execute 'fetch' on 'Window': Illegal invocation
const _fetch = opts.fetch!;
let response = await _fetch(request);
for (const fn of interceptors.response._fns) {
response = await fn(response, request, opts);
}
const result = {
request,
response,
};
if (response.ok) {
if (
response.status === 204 ||
response.headers.get('Content-Length') === '0'
) {
return {
data: {},
...result,
};
}
const parseAs =
(opts.parseAs === 'auto'
? getParseAs(response.headers.get('Content-Type'))
: opts.parseAs) ?? 'json';
if (parseAs === 'stream') {
return {
data: response.body,
...result,
};
}
let data = await response[parseAs]();
if (parseAs === 'json') {
if (opts.responseValidator) {
await opts.responseValidator(data);
}
if (opts.responseTransformer) {
data = await opts.responseTransformer(data);
}
}
return {
data,
...result,
};
}
let error = await response.text();
try {
error = JSON.parse(error);
} catch {
// noop
}
let finalError = error;
for (const fn of interceptors.error._fns) {
finalError = (await fn(error, response, request, opts)) as string;
}
finalError = finalError || ({} as string);
if (opts.throwOnError) {
throw finalError;
}
return {
error: finalError,
...result,
};
};
return {
buildUrl,
connect: (options) => request({ ...options, method: 'CONNECT' }),
delete: (options) => request({ ...options, method: 'DELETE' }),
get: (options) => request({ ...options, method: 'GET' }),
getConfig,
head: (options) => request({ ...options, method: 'HEAD' }),
interceptors,
options: (options) => request({ ...options, method: 'OPTIONS' }),
patch: (options) => request({ ...options, method: 'PATCH' }),
post: (options) => request({ ...options, method: 'POST' }),
put: (options) => request({ ...options, method: 'PUT' }),
request,
setConfig,
trace: (options) => request({ ...options, method: 'TRACE' }),
};
};
